Where is the Kampas family from?

You can see how Kampas families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Kampas family name was found in the USA in 1920. In 1920 there were 8 Kampas families living in Pennsylvania. This was about 28% of all the recorded Kampas's in USA. Pennsylvania had the highest population of Kampas families in 1920.

What is the average Kampas lifespan?

Between 1967 and 2004, in the United States, Kampas life expectancy was at its lowest point in 2002, and highest in 1995. The average life expectancy for Kampas in 1967 was 73, and 80 in 2004.

An unusually short lifespan might indicate that your Kampas ancestors lived in harsh conditions. A short lifespan might also indicate health problems that were once prevalent in your family.
